My family devotes everything about our show to the actual Christmas story. Several years ago the national Christian touring group Truth (4 members of which later formed the Christian supergroup 4Him) recorded an exceptionally moving track called The Carolers Song that has become by far our favorite. We are switching this year to RGB pixels only, and are extremely excited about new potential for the vocals, orchestration, and meaning of its lyrics. Here is a link

 https://youtu.be/EPcJeSnXwrw

Odd factoid: the songwriter, Mark Harris, who has written or co-written 25 number-one Contemporary Christian songs joined the staff of a church less than a mile from our home in 2013.
